去除json数据php 删除json中的一个元素

php 接收到json双引号前有转义符\,怎么去除PHP stripslashes() 函数
stripslashes() 函数删除:反斜杠及由 addslashes() 函数添加去除json数据php的反斜杠 。
该函数可用于清理从数据库中或者从 HTML 表单中取回去除json数据php的数据 。
【去除json数据php 删除json中的一个元素】实例代码:
?php
echo stripslashes("Who\'s Bill Gates?");
?
php怎么删除json里面的数据?参考方法就是先把文件读出来,把不要的数组元素删了后再写回去;
参考代码如下:
// std::string jsonPath // json文件路径
Json::Reader reader;
Json::Value root;
ifstream is;
is.open (jsonPath.c_str(), std::ios::binary );
if (reader.parse(is, root))
{
std::string code;
Json::Value value;
int size = root.size();
for (int i = 0; isize; i++)
{
if(条件)
{
value[i] = root[i];
}
}
is.close();
Json::FastWriter writer;
std::string json_append_file = writer.write(value);
std::ofstream ofs;
ofs.open(jsonPath.c_str());
ofsjson_append_file;
ofs.close();
}
PHP生成json后咋去掉[]JSON 格式去除json数据php的数据如果去掉 [ 去除json数据php的话可能无法正常转成数组去除json数据php了 。
去除去除json数据php的话可以用字符串替换函数去除json数据php:
$json;
$newJson = str_replace(['[', ']'], ['', ''], $json);
echo $newJson;
关于去除json数据php和删除json中的一个元素的介绍到此就结束了 , 不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站 。

    推荐阅读